Never-Ending Nightmare (Japanese: むげんあんやへのいざない Invitation to the Endless Night) is a damage-dealing Ghost-type Z-Move introduced in Generation VII.

Effect

Never-Ending Nightmare inflicts damage. Its power and whether it is a special or physical move depends on the move it is based on.

Base move Power Category
Astonish 100 Physical
Hex 160 Special
Lick 100 Physical
Moongeist Beam 180 Special
Night Shade 100 Special
Ominous Wind 120 Special
Phantom Force 175 Physical
Shadow Ball 160 Special
Shadow Bone 160 Physical
Shadow Claw 140 Physical
Shadow Force 190 Physical
Shadow Punch 120 Physical
Shadow Sneak 100 Physical
Spectral Thief 175 Physical
Spirit Shackle 160 Physical

Description

Games Description
SM Deep-seated grudges summoned by the user's Z-Power trap the target. The power varies, depending on the original move.


Learnset

Any Pokémon can use Never-Ending Nightmare if it knows a damaging Ghost-type move, holds a Ghostium Z, and if its Trainer wears a Z-Ring.
